This week at FESPA 2019 (14th-17th May, 2019, Messe Munich, Germany, stand B5-E30), Canon is sharing game-changing innovations designed to help signage and graphics producers create high margin end-user products and improve operational efficiencies to fuel business growth.

Canon Europe today launches the new Océ Colorado 1650 printer, extending customer choice by expanding the series of roll-to-roll large format devices featuring Canon UVgel technology. The Océ Colorado 1650 introduces a new flexible ink and Océ FLXfinish, meeting the needs of customers wanting increased media versatility to fuel business growth.

Durst P5 350 Hybrid Printer

Durst, manufacturer of advanced digital printing and production technologies, has today at FESPA 2019 in Munich, Germany, launched the P5 350 and P5 210 new printing systems for large format specialists based on the P5 technology platform.

Electronics For Imaging, Inc. (Nasdaq:EFII) technologies on display at the ISA International Sign Expo can give signage professionals important competitive advantages in a wide range of display graphics applications. EFI’s exhibit in booth 535 at the April 24-26Las Vegas tradeshow features the new, next-generation EFI™ VUTEk® h5 hybrid flatbed/roll-to-roll LED for higher-volume printing, and the high-end EFI VUTEk FabriVU® 340i printer offering superior-quality soft-signage printing with in-line calendering, both of them running using the newest versions of EFI’s Fiery® proServer digital front ends (DFEs).

As industrial and functional printing find their way into new production processes, more than 20 members of ESMA, the European Specialist Printing Manufacturers Association, are presenting their solutions at FESPA Global Expo, 14-17 May 2019 in Munich. The ESMA pavilion in hall A6, booth A70, features an Industrial Print Showcase and offers expert sessions dedicated to screen and digital inkjet technologies, new market opportunities and print business innovation.
